The ingredients needed to make Idli, Sambhar, Vada, Uttapam:
  1. Get For idli and uttapam
  2. Get 2 cups ..rice…
  3. You need .1/2 cup. Flatten rice
  4. Provide 1 cup. .urad dal
  5. Prepare 1 Tomato. chop..
  6. Prepare 1 chop onion
  7. Use As taste. . Salt
  8. Get 1/2 tsp …methidana
  9. Get 1 tsp .jaggery powder
  10. Get for Sambhar
  11. Take 1 cup .tuhar dal
  12. Prepare 1 tsp ..haldi
  13. You need As taste. . Salt
  14. Get 1/2 tsp ..red chilli
  15. Provide 1 tbsp .sambhar masala
  16. Take 1 tsp ..mustard seeds
  17. Get 10 ..curry leaves
  18. You need 1 tbsp ..oil
  19. You need 2 pc. . Whole red chilli dry
  20. Use 1/2 tsp ..hing
  21. Take 1 pc. ..long brinjal
  22. Use 1 pc. .carrot
  23. Get 1 pc. .raddish
  24. Get 1 pc. .lauki
  25. Provide 2 pc. drum stick
  26. Get 2 Onion
  27. Take 2 .tomato
  28. Get 1 tbsp lemon juice
  29. Take for Vada
  30. Provide 1/2 cup.. . Dhulli moong dal
  31. You need 1/3 cup.. Chana dal
  32. Get 1/3 cup dhulli urad dal
  33. Take As taste. .. Salt
  34. Prepare 1/4 tsp ..red chilli powder
  35. Provide as needed For vada frying… Oil
Instructions to make Idli, Sambhar, Vada, Uttapam:
  1. Dal and rice ko wash ke soak ke coarsely grind ke jaggery, salt, grinded method Dana and grinded flatten rice mix kar full day and overnight cover ke rakh de.
  2. After two days batter ko divide ke le half se idli and half se uttapam bana le. Uttapam ke upper chop onion and chop tomato laga le.
  3. Tuhar dal ko wash ke cooker main dal kar water add ke salt, haldi and red chilli dal ke boil kar le. All veggies ko wash ke cut kar le
  4. Wok main oil heat kar hing, mustard seeds, curry leaves and whole red chilli ko thorh ke add karein.
  5. Diced cut onion and tomato add ke all veggies, salt and sambhar masala dal kar mix ke cook kar le.
  6. After cook veggies and cooked dal mix well 5 minutes cook ke lemon juice add kar de. Sambhar r ready.
  7. Chana dal, urad dal and moong dal ko wash kar soak karein.
  8. After soak coarsely grind ke le isme salt and red. Chilli mix ke vada machine main batter pour ke le.
  9. Heat oil vada machine se oil main vada dal ke fry kar le.
  10. Then enjoy Sambhar, vada, idli and uttapam.
